Yesterday, Opta released a tweet stating that by definition, Virgil van Dijk had been dribbled past for the first time in 65 matches during the Community Shield defeat to Manchester City – in which we cruelly lost on penalties after dominating the game.
65 – During the Community Shield final, Virgil van Dijk was dribbled past for the first time in his last 65 competitive appearances (by Gabriel Jesus) for @LFC since Mikel Merino did so for Newcastle in March 2018. Human. #CommunityShield pic.twitter.com/24B6WFcKUw
